Fire detector provides alternative to ionisation fire detectors
Published: October 2007
The PITR photo-thermal infra-red detector from System Sensor Europe has been developed to provide an efficient and environmentally benign alternative to the venerable ionisation detector. PITR sensors are designed for the rapid detection of fast-flaming fires and consist of independent photo-electrical, thermal and infra-red sensors, which are managed and controlled by sophisticated algorithms running on an embedded processor. The addition of the infra-red sensor to the established photo-thermal multi-sensor design is said to increase performance so that it can replace ionisation detectors with no degradation in speed of response or generating more false alarms.
